Enjoy Rich Internet Experiences with JavaFX


Enjoy Rich Internet Experiences with JavaFX

JavaFX is a rich client platform, integrated with Java Runtime, that you can create and deliver rich internet experiences.

It is the a combination of a scripting language: JavaFX Script, a rich client platform and set of tools for a productive and collaborative developer-designer workflow.

You can refer JavaFX as alternative for Flash & Silverlight.

JavaFX platform currently consists:

  • NetBeans IDE 6.5 for JavaFX 1.0 (development environment)
  • JavaFX 1.0 Production Suite (a set of tools & Photoshop & Illustrator pluging allowing graphics to be exported to JavaFX applications)

JavaFX can run on millions of devices including desktop, browsers, mobile devices & more as it requires Java Runtime which is ready on many environments.

Open Zoom – An Open Source Framework for UI


OpenZoom is an open source framework used for creating zoomable user interfaces.

Open Zoom - An Open Source Framework for UI

The power behind OpenZoom is Flex MultiScaleImage component, which is built on top of the OpenZoom framework.

Name and working of OpenZoom is Similar to Silverlight’s Deep Zoom control.

The component has built-in support for keyboard / mouse activities & supports Deep Zoom, Zoomify & OpenZoom images.

Deep Zoom Images With Seadragon Ajax


Seadragon is a technology, by Microsoft, for deeply zooming images of any size. It provides almost perfect transitions independent from the sizes of the images.

Seadragon Ajax is an interface for using/embedding this technology to any website.
